WHEREAS, the Board of Directors of the Company (the "Board of Directors") has authorized the granting to Optionee, for services to be rendered by Optionee as a consultant to the Company, in accordance with the terms of a Consulting Agreement ("Consulting Agreement") between the Company and Optionee entered into on March 28, 2007, of a non-qualified stock option to purchase the number of shares of common stock (“Common Stock”) of the Company specified in Paragraph 1 hereof at the price specified therein, such option to be for the term and upon the terms and conditions hereinafter stated in this Option Agreement.
NOW THEREFORE, in consideration of the premises and of the undertakings of the Parties hereto contained herein, it is hereby agreed:
1. | NUMBER OF SHARES: OPTION PRICE |
Pursuant to said action of the Board of Directors, the Company hereby grants to Optionee, in consideration of consulting services to be performed for the benefit of the Company, the option ("Option") to purchase up to Three Million (3,000,000) shares ("Option Shares") of Common Stock of the Company, at the exercise price equal to twenty cents ($0.20) a share (the “Exercise Price”).
Notwithstanding anything in this Option Agreement to the contrary, in no event will the Optionee be entitled to exercise the Option to purchase Option shares in excess of such number of shares of Common Stock beneficially owned by the Optionee and its affiliates (other than shares of Common Stock which may be deemed beneficially owned through the ownership of the unexercised Warrants and the unexercised or unconverted portion of any other securities of the Company, subject to a limitation on conversion or exercise) that would result in beneficial ownership by the Holder and its affiliates of more than 4.9% of the outstanding shares of Common Stock. For purposes of the immediately preceding sentence, beneficial ownership is determined in accordance with Section 13(d) of the Securities Exchange Act of 1934, as amended, and Regulation 13D-G thereunder.
This option will expire five (5) years from the date of signing of this Option Agreement.
3. | SHARES SUBJECT TO EXERCISE |
The options are immediately exercisable and remain subject to exercise for the term specified in Section 2, regardless of the termination of the Consulting Agreement.
4. | METHOD AND TIME OF EXERCISE |
The Option may be exercised by written notice delivered to the Company in the form attached hereto as Exhibit A stating the number of shares with respect to which the Option is being exercised together with either a check made payable to the Company in the amount of the purchase price of the shares, or a wire transfer in the amount of the purchase price of the shares. Only whole shares may be purchased. The Company must carry out any and all acts to ensure that the Company and its transfer agent duly and properly issue the shares underlying the options to Optionee.
5. | EXERCISE ON TERMINATION |
This Option will not terminate as a result of the termination of Optionee's services as a consultant to the Company or as a result of an early termination of the Consulting Agreement by Company.

7. | OPTIONEE NOT A SHAREHOLDER |
Optionee has no rights as a shareholder with respect to the Common Stock of the Company covered by the Option until the date of issuance of a stock certificate or stock certificates to him upon exercise of the Option. No adjustment will be made for dividends or other rights for which the record date is prior to the date such stock certificate or certificates are issued.
8. | RESTRICTIONS ON SALE OF SHARES |
Optionee represents and agrees that, upon Optionee's exercise of the Option in whole or part, unless there is in effect at that time under the Securities Act of 1933 a registration statement relating to the shares issued to him, he will acquire the shares issuable upon exercise of this Option for the purpose of investment and not with a view to their resale or further distribution, and that upon such exercise thereof Optionee will furnish to the Company a written statement to such effect satisfactory to the Company in form and substance.

If there is any change in the capitalization of the Company affecting in any manner the number or kind of outstanding shares of Common Stock of the Company, whether by stock dividend, stock split, reclassification or recapitalization of such stock, or because the Company has merged or consolidated with one or more other corporations (and provided the Option does not thereby terminate pursuant to Section 2 hereof), then the number and kind of shares then subject to the Option and the price to be paid therefor will be appropriately adjusted by the Company; provided however, that in no event will any such adjustment result in the Company's being required to sell or issue any fractional shares. Any such adjustment will be made without change in the aggregate purchase price applicable to the unexercised portion of the Option, but with an appropriate adjustment to the price of each Share or other unit of security covered by this Option.
12. | CESSATION OF CORPORATE EXISTENCE |
Notwithstanding any other provision of this Option, under the dissolution or liquidation of the Company, the reorganization, merger or consolidation of the Company with one or more corporations as a result of which the Company is not the surviving corpora-tion, or the sale of substantially all the assets of the Company or of more than fifty percent (50%) of the then outstanding stock of the Company to another corporation or other entity, the Option granted hereunder will terminate; provided, however, that within fifteen (15) days before the effective date of such dissolution or liquidation, merger or consolidation or sale of assets in which the Company is not the surviving corporation, the Company will tender to Optionee, an option to purchase shares of the surviving corporation, and such new option or options will contain such terms and provisions substantially in accordance with this Option in order to preserve the rights and benefits of this Option.
